Subject: DR drill — ProctorLine queue, Thursday

Hi all,

Welcome aboard. Thursday we run the quarterly disaster-recovery drill for the ProctorLine exam-proctoring queue. We'll fail over to the Marrow Hill standby cluster and restore the queue from snapshot. No student-facing impact expected.

To initiate the restore, the console asks for the recovery passphrase, which is:

strongbox words: silath-briwyn-julox-olimir-raldor-zorwyn-ralius-ralwyn-belius-sildor

Ticket: Signature verification failing on Wayfinder deep-link router

Since the 2.9 rollout, the Wayfinder mobile router rejects signed deep-link payloads from the campaign service with "untrusted signer." Links fall back to the home screen. Suspected cause: the router image shipped without the rotated verification key. For review, the key the router should be trusting is the following.

release key, kawif-hawep: bky13_X7TGuRG4Zu4ZJ

If the Brackenford load balancer marks pool nodes unhealthy, curl /healthz on each node directly from the bastion. A 503 with drain=true means a deploy is in progress; do not re-enable manually. Otherwise restart the probe-responder service and confirm recovery within two intervals. Probe queries to the internal status API require the key below.

service key, fawip-bajef: kto11_Qt5wZK9vdNC

The revamped password reset flow in the Lockstone API replaces emailed links with short-lived reset grants. Plugins initiate a reset by posting the account handle to the reset endpoint, then poll the grant status until the user confirms out-of-band. Grants expire after ten minutes and are single-use; a consumed grant returns a terminal status rather than an error. All reset endpoints require plugin-level authentication via the bearer token shown below.

bearer token for yajop-tahop: eyJhbGciOiJIUzI1NiIsInR5cCI6IkpXVCJ9.eyJzdWIiOiIC9r503In0.M9JwY-EN